Tips on how to go about it: 

Plan it ahead keeping your budget in mind.

Paint your kitchen in light, minimum contrast colour if it is small or medium sized or use dark and contrast if it is a huge kitchen.

Comfort and safety first and that’s why your plumbing needs to be dealt first.  Faucets available in copper and stainless finish.  Coordinate your sink with the faucet’s colour.

Place cabinets and drawers in perfect positions.  Introduce Kitchen Island in your kitchen if your space and budget allows.

There is almost no kitchen without Kitchen appliances.  Find proper place for your refrigerator, dishwasher, microwave, toaster and coffee machine.  Incorporate some of them inside your deep cabinets so that your appliance does not give a cluttered look.

Lighting is as crucial as buying a refrigerator.  Without proper lighting you wouldn’t want to cook in your kitchen.  What if you are planning to have a kitchen PC installed to utilize time that your microwave takes to cook.

You are going to have windows in your kitchen apart from the exhaust.  Hang cafe curtains or kitchen swags. When planning to invite friends and family all spring for barbecue design an outdoor kitchen along with an indoor one.
